Part of Nehiyawetan: Let's Speak Cree (Series 2 -- 6 parts).
Nehiyawetan means "Let's speak Cree". This dynamic six part series combines live action and animation in an innovative approach to making the Cree language accessible to young children. It follows a group of Aboriginal children as they learn to speak Cree in the city. The approach taken reinforces learning through play, music, adventure and storytelling. Nehiyawetan: Let’s Speak Cree promotes language retention, offers a Cree perspective of the world and encourages smart choices about living in the city.
The harvest is here--it's time to celebrate the arrival of a new season and the perfect time to learn about the four seasons of the year! Children are welcomed at the Aboriginal Garden at the University of British Columbia, where Kai and Kayla help serve the elders and eat the delicious harvest meal. Guest performer Renae Morriseau drops in to sing a song about the seasons.
